POSITION SUMMARY
This position will be responsible for strategic sourcing. Driving cost, quality and delivery improvements, for direct materials, supplied to our Mexico, US and Canadian manufacturing plants.
Cost
- Generate RFQ’s to validate incumbent supplier has best in class cost.
- Platform on best cost / best performing products across all brands & business divisions.
- Monitor cost drivers, lead inflation mitigation & deflation recovery negotiations.
- Qualify alternative suppliers to drive competition.
- Identifies and tracks cost-saving and cost-reduction opportunities and builds a culture of long-term savings without compromising supply assurance or quality.
Quality
- Develop capability of chronic performing suppliers, define & execute exit plan if performance does not improve.
- Track cost of poor quality, for supplier related issues recover 100% of costs.
- Analyze warranty claims + pareto. Collaborate with vendors to implement changes to improve durability.
- Partner with internal team & suppliers, to resolve incoming rejects, leveraging 5 why’s + root cause and CAP.
- Co-ordinate on-site audits, to validate supplier’s technical capability and quality systems.
Delivery
- Evaluate ways to take cost out of the supply chain (alternative transport modes, alternative carriers, in bond shipments etc).
- Implement strategies to improve service levels (Kanban, localization, local warehousing etc).
- Driving working capital improvements, without increasing inventory $’s (pay terms, MOQ’s).
- Identify & mitigate longer term supply risk (dual sourcing, capacity expansion, financial health checks).
- Support plant Buyers, to help resolve short term supply challenges, exploring all opportunities to maintain supply continuity.
New Product Introductions
- Support project team throughout development phase (samples, FA reports, line trials & pilot builds).
- Lead supplier evaluation and selection process (RFQ, validate quote, quality audit and technical reviews).
- Set up robust supply chain, designed to drive velocity & flexibility.
- Negotiate unit price, pay terms, MOQ’s, lead times & supply agreements.
